“Do you believe in reincarnation?”

This was the first question Kuang Tianqing asked Dao Qiankun that night when they met.

Dao Qiankun merely smiled at Kuang Tianqing’s question and didn’t answer directly. Instead, he asked curiously, “Oh? Asking me this question on the last night before the competition, have you encountered a reincarnated person?”

Kuang Tianqing folded her arms across her chest, her long hair swaying in the wind, and spoke indifferently, “I was just wondering… if the legends about rebirth and reincarnation are true, what impact would the widespread adoption of life-extension technology have?”

Dao Qiankun walked to the window, looked at the moon in the sky, and said calmly, “In this world, even if there is reincarnation, it must be under the control of the Immortals.”

“If it’s under the Immortals’ control, then how everyone reincarnates and how long their lifespan is… that becomes a matter of profit, a matter of governing Kunxu.”

“In this hypothesis, the longer the lifespan, the fewer times people reincarnate; the shorter the lifespan, the more times people reincarnate. From the most extreme scenario of universal immortality to the other extreme of universal death, different developmental directions stem from the setting of average lifespan.”

“How long one lives and how long it takes to reincarnate will determine the interests of all parties, and even more so, the direction of Kunxu’s development in Immortal Dao technology…”

Listening to Dao Qiankun’s words, Kuang Tianqing’s gaze sharpened slightly, and she said coldly, “You’re right. So, if there is reincarnation, then there would be a Reincarnation Group.”

“And the Reincarnation Group wouldn’t allow the average lifespan of society to easily increase.”

Kuang Tianqing walked up to Dao Qiankun, her eyes fixed on him, as if trying to see through his every secret.

Kuang Tianqing: “If the Reincarnation Group exists, then facing the promotion of life-extension technology, they would certainly suppress it in every way possible.”

Dao Qiankun looked at Kuang Tianqing calmly: “Perhaps.”

Kuang Tianqing continued to stare at him, saying, “The Huashen of Wanfa Four Schools haven’t agreed to the acquisition and promotion of life-extension technology until now. Is it because they considered the existence of reincarnation?”

Dao Qiankun looked directly at her and said, “Are you asking if the Reincarnation Group is behind me?”

“Kuang Tianqing, you’re taking this too seriously. What we’ve just discussed are all just hypotheses. Whether reincarnation exists… who can say for sure?”

“You can trace all the sources of my wealth, and you should be perfectly clear about who I am.”

Kuang Tianqing sneered, “Reincarnation is a forbidden topic. Even if the Reincarnation Group truly exists, it cannot be openly publicized. So, if the Reincarnation Group were to interfere in the world, it would never do so openly, always operating in the shadows, existing only in rumors and hearsay.”

Dao Qiankun didn’t directly address Kuang Tianqing’s question, but suddenly said, “Do you know what Immortal Sect cultivation method the three Huashen of Wanfa hope I choose?”

Kuang Tianqing asked, “What method?”

Dao Qiankun said, “Fajie Shenzao Zhang.”

Kuang Tianqing’s body trembled, and she asked in surprise, “Fajie?”

“Is this Wanfa University’s choice? Or…”

“Wanfa Sect’s choice?”

Inside the mourning hall.

Kuang Tianqing snapped out of her memories of that night and looked again at Dao Qiankun’s corpse, sitting cross-legged in front of her.

She thought to herself, “Dao Qiankun, if you really are dead, you’re truly at peace, not as tired as I am now.”

“Do you know that since your death, I’ve become a complete target, and one misstep could lead to eternal damnation?”

Although everyone in the world seemed to be watching her now, hoping she would win the championship, hoping she would choose an Immortal Sect cultivation method, and choose the future direction of development for the world.

And although under such scrutiny, her finances, security, and other conditions were all rising.

But Kuang Tianqing could feel like she was sitting on a powder keg, and the slightest misstep would blow her to pieces.

Rubbing her increasingly aching forehead, Kuang Tianqing thought to herself, “Damn it… I need to make the old geezers pay more.”

As she pondered, Kuang Tianqing began to walk around Dao Qiankun, as if observing something.

Zhang Yu, who was nearby, asked, “What are you looking for?”

Kuang Tianqing turned to look at Zhang Yu and asked, “Do you think Dao Qiankun is really dead?”

Zhang Yu was slightly stunned: “Huh?”

Kuang Tianqing didn’t miss any change in Zhang Yu’s expression and said word by word, “Do you believe he’s the kind of person who would choose to commit suicide before the competition, giving up his chance to compete?”

Zhang Yu frowned and said, “What are you trying to say? Do you think Brother Dao isn’t dead? For you, whether he’s dead or not, not being able to participate in the competition is a good thing, isn’t it? At least you can confidently extend everyone’s lifespan.”

Kuang Tianqing snorted coldly, looking at Zhang Yu, and said, “It seems you’re on the side that opposes universal life extension? Do you think I don’t know the downsides of life extension? Reduced population mobility, decreased innovation, the whole world becoming increasingly stagnant… But it’s still much better than Wanfa’s choice.”

Zhang Yu’s eyes narrowed, and he said, “Wanfa’s choice? You know what it is?”

Kuang Tianqing smiled, “You don’t know? Dao Qiankun didn’t tell you?”

Curiosity surged in Zhang Yu’s heart. To get an answer from Kuang Tianqing, he deliberately said, “No matter what Wanfa’s choice is, it’s always better than life extension, isn’t it?”

But Kuang Tianqing didn’t tell Zhang Yu what Wanfa’s choice was. Instead, she changed the subject, “The older generation of Huashen living a few more years, you all say this is bad, that’s bad.”

“But have you ever thought about what would happen if the older generation of Huashen died and the new generation of Huashen came up?”

Seeing Zhang Yu’s bewildered look, Kuang Tianqing pursed her lips and said, “You should read the Yuanying theses of Tianmo Four Schools from recent years, especially those by the Huashen candidates.”

“Although if I were in their position, I would probably make the same choices as them.”

“After all, only by being more radical, by creating more exorbitant profits, and by maintaining growth, can one gain the support of Tianmo Sect and become the new generation of Huashen at Tianmo University.”

Kuang Tianqing sighed, “But from a student’s perspective, if I had to choose a Huashen, I’d rather the older generation of Huashen continue to live, at least they aren’t so radical.”

Zhang Yu thought to himself, “No… you’ve already turned into a woman to get eight Huashen to give you extra lessons, isn’t that radical? How radical can the Huashen candidates of Tianmo Four Schools be?”

Kuang Tianqing sensed Zhang Yu’s expression, changes in his posture, and fluctuations in his spiritual power and aura. Various analytical results kept appearing in her eye sockets. She thought, “This kid seems to know nothing.”

As Zhang Yu watched Kuang Tianqing begin to check around Dao Qiankun again, he quickly said, “What are you doing? If you mess around again, I’ll call for help!”

As he spoke, Zhang Yu took the opportunity to circle behind Dao Qiankun, wanting to see if there was anything wrong with the corpse.

“Nothing happening?”

Standing behind Dao Qiankun with a hint of nervousness, feeling nothing was happening, Zhang Yu thought, “Right, if something could be triggered so easily, it would have been discovered during the autopsy.”

Just then, Kuang Tianqing’s hand pressed onto Dao Qiankun’s shoulder.

The next moment, a figure suddenly emerged from the corpse and said coldly, “Who disturbs my peaceful slumber?”

Zhang Yu, seeing the figure, was shocked and said, “Brother Dao?”

Kuang Tianqing looked at the figure but frowned and said, “Doesn’t seem like the real Dao Qiankun.”

The figure looked at Kuang Tianqing and said, “If I’m not Dao Qiankun, then who am I?”

Kuang Tianqing talked with the figure for a few sentences and then, after another examination, said directly, “Hmph, just a tool spirit with some memories. It probably appears when the corpse is touched. What a boring thing.”

After searching and finding no clues, Kuang Tianqing left the mourning hall, leaving only Zhang Yu staring at the tool spirit, both wide-eyed.

Zhang Yu spoke a few words to the tool spirit but found that it only repeated the same things over and over. Feeling bored, he continued his cultivation.

In the blink of an eye, a night passed. Zhang Yu’s demonic blood was completely refined, and his Yaosheng Wanbian Shenjing advanced to a higher level.

Although no secrets were found on Dao Qiankun’s corpse, the “Immortal Descendant” Dao seed flashed again, which strengthened Zhang Yu’s resolve to continue cultivating here.

So, in the following days, while acquiring demonic blood daily, Zhang Yu cultivated the Yaosheng Wanbian Shenjing in the mourning hall, accompanying Dao Qiankun’s corpse.

During this period, the “Immortal Descendant” Dao seed on the corpse flashed more and more frequently, from once a day to several times a day.

Zhang Yu had a hunch that as long as he continued to stay, he would eventually get a chance to replicate the Dao seed.

With the purchase of demonic blood and the maintenance of various magical artifacts and skeletal remains, Zhang Yu’s spiritual coin balance steadily declined, soon reaching around 260 spiritual coins.

“Next, I need to cultivate Dao arts to level 20 and continue to buy demonic blood. Subsequent competitions also require maintenance of magical artifacts and skeletal remains. If replicating the Dao seed costs money, and if I need to modify magical artifacts later…”

Zhang Yu quickly calculated in his mind and felt that the money he had now, though seemingly a lot, was still insufficient.

Especially if his goal was to win the championship, no amount of spiritual coins would be too much.

However, with the exposure of the final’s content and rules, the subsequent fees also changed significantly.

Although he could earn fees from every battle, the one-on-one format, the distribution of popularity, and the reduced duration all led to a decrease in Zhang Yu’s fees.

Especially in one-on-one combat competitions, audiences paid more attention to powerful players like Kuang Tianqing, Yan Xiang, Tiansheng Gong, and Cang Shenyu, who were the top students of their respective schools.

If Zhang Yu hadn’t gained significant popularity from his previous battle with Ling Pojun, his fees would probably have dropped even further.

“Currently, after negotiations, the next match fee company is willing to offer around 70 spiritual coins.”

“It would be great if it could be more.”

While Zhang Yu was pondering these matters, Ye Xingli sent him a message.

Ye Xingli: Junior Brother, aren’t you going to live stream?

Zhang Yu: What’s wrong?

Ye Xingli: More and more Jihu fans have been scolding you these days. It’s a good opportunity for you to make money through live streaming.

Zhang Yu: But I’m cultivating.

Ye Xingli: Isn’t making money the best cultivation? What cultivation could be better than live streaming to make money?
